Digestive Issues: Gas or constipation might cause swelling while resting

Swelling around the rectal area during sleep can often be traced back to digestive issues, particularly gas or constipation. When the body is at rest, the digestive system slows down, allowing gas to accumulate in the intestines. This buildup can exert pressure on the surrounding tissues, leading to noticeable swelling. Similarly, constipation can cause the rectum to become distended as stool hardens and remains in the colon, creating a visible and sometimes uncomfortable enlargement. Understanding these mechanisms is the first step in addressing the issue effectively.

To alleviate gas-related swelling, consider dietary adjustments before bedtime. Avoid foods known to cause gas, such as beans, lentils, cruciferous vegetables (like broccoli or cabbage), and carbonated beverages. Instead, opt for light, easily digestible meals rich in fiber but low in fermentable oligosaccharides, disaccharides, monosaccharides, and polyols (FODMAPs). Over-the-counter remedies like simethicone (125–250 mg, up to four times daily) can help break down gas bubbles, reducing bloating and associated swelling. For children or the elderly, consult a healthcare provider for appropriate dosages.

Constipation-induced swelling requires a different approach. Increasing water intake to at least 8–10 glasses daily softens stool, making it easier to pass. Incorporate soluble fiber sources like oats, apples, or psyllium husk (5–10 grams daily) into the diet, but do so gradually to avoid exacerbating gas. Mild physical activity, such as a 15-minute evening walk, stimulates bowel movements and prevents stool from stagnating in the colon. If symptoms persist, a gentle osmotic laxative like magnesium hydroxide (2,400–4,800 mg daily) can provide relief, but long-term use should be monitored by a healthcare professional.

While these measures are effective, caution is necessary. Over-reliance on laxatives can lead to dependency, and excessive fiber without adequate hydration may worsen constipation. For individuals with underlying conditions like irritable bowel syndrome (IBS) or inflammatory bowel disease (IBD), consult a gastroenterologist to tailor a safe and effective plan. Monitoring symptoms and adjusting interventions based on response ensures both comfort and long-term digestive health. Understanding Hernias and Their Impact

Hernias occur when an internal organ or tissue protrudes through a weak spot in the surrounding muscle or connective tissue. In the case of anal enlargement, a perineal hernia might be the culprit. This type of hernia develops in the perineum, the area between the anus and the genitals, and can cause swelling, discomfort, and a visible bulge. Tumors: A Hidden Threat

Another potential cause of anal enlargement is the presence of a tumor. Tumors in the anal region can be benign (non-cancerous) or malignant (cancerous), and both types can cause swelling and discomfort. Anal sac adenocarcinoma, for instance, is a type of cancer that arises from the anal sacs, small glands located on either side of the anus. This cancer is more common in older, small-breed dogs but can occur in other species. As the tumor grows, it may cause the anal area to appear enlarged, especially during sleep when the surrounding muscles are relaxed. Early detection is crucial, as malignant tumors can metastasize to other parts of the body, making treatment more challenging.

Frequently asked questions

Your dog's stomach may appear larger when he sleeps due to relaxation of the abdominal muscles and normal digestive processes. This is usually harmless and part of the body's natural resting state.

Yes, mild swelling or enlargement of a dog's belly during sleep is often normal, caused by deep breathing, gas, or relaxed muscles. However, sudden or severe swelling warrants a vet check.

In most cases, it’s not a concern, but if the swelling is accompanied by lethargy, vomiting, or difficulty breathing, it could indicate a serious condition like bloat or gastrointestinal issues, requiring immediate veterinary attention.

Monitor for additional symptoms like restlessness, whining, or a hard, distended abdomen. If you notice any of these, consult your vet promptly, as it could signal an emergency.
